Loading movies ...
Movie Poster

Down Twisted (1987)

Quality: SD
Country: United States, Mexico
Release Date: 01 Mar 1987
Director:Albert Pyun
Rating: 5.5 (IMDb)
Runtime: 88 min

Storyline:

Down Twisted (1987) When a levelheaded waitress decides to help her shady friend against her better judgment, she becomes a target of a deadly international gang of thieves who are after a priceless San Lucas' relic. A bumbling stranger helps her.